Are both the M5s yours ?, if so, what are your findings between the two ?. Would you say the CS is noticeably quicker than the Competition ?.
I just picked up my CS and traded in my comp for it.

It feels like a completely different car. Obviously I'm still under 1200 mi so haven't really pushed it that hard but even the first 5 minutes I drove the car around, it felt way different. It feels much more nimble and just dialed in.

Straight line just from what I've felt so far isn't much different, as it shouldn't really be, but as a whole the car feels way better.
